The set includes minifigures of main characters Martin Brody, Matt Hooper and Sam Quint, as well as a harpoon for shark hunting.

The set, which is priced at $150, will be available in stores on August 6, with “early access” starting on August 3. Designers will be able to build the scene on a foundation that simulates the ocean. A specially printed tile inside the set reads, “You’ll need a bigger boat.”

By the way, earlier Lego, in collaboration with the European Space Agency (ESA), created Lego bricks from meteorite dust, and they will be available in select stores until September 20, including the flagship store in Manhattan.
